I've a mapping with 4 mapplets and one target (xml file),
i want to run the mapplet one by one;
run the mapplet 1 and after the mapplet 2 ....
not all the mapplet in the same time;

is it possible ?

thanks
ArtieChoke (Programmer)
27 May 08 19:10
If your path goes from 1 to 2 to 3 to 4, then it can be done. Otherwise, you will need to make four maps and four workflows.
